Master in Statistics - Introduction
The Department of Statistics, Operations and Management Science, a unit of the College of Business Administration, encourages strong applications for the M.S. degree program specializing in business and industrial statistics. The College of Business has earned international recognition for executive education courses that attract managers and engineers to learn how statistics can be used to improve processes.
Statistics students profit from this outreach activity by interacting with people in industry and being exposed to important real-world problems in the classroom and to enhance internship and employment opportunities.
Your degree in statistics will open the door to a variety of career choices. Our graduates work in diverse fields for many different companies, and routinely report better-than-average starting salaries. In addition, many report substantial pay increases during or after their first year of employment.
Recent students in the last two to four years have typical starting salaries in the $60,000 to $80,000 range. Sample companies and government agencies of past students include:

Graduate Certificate in Applied Statistical Strategies
This for-credit program consists of successful completion of four, separate 3-semester hour credit courses. Each course is fully approved for graduate credit and can count toward UT's Masters in Statistics or towards a UT minor in Statistics.
Our certificate program is customized to meet your individual needs. If you wish, you can take all of your classes without coming to Knoxville.
